Chelsea 2 Porto 2 (5-4 On Penalties) : Kuku Fidelis, Uwakwe Benched As Blues Reach UYL Final
Published: April 20, 2018
Chelsea moved into the final of the UEFA Youth League on Friday afternoon, ousting Porto on penalties after a 2-2 draw in their semi-final game held at the Centre Sportif De Colovray.
While Faustino Anjorin was not included in the youth Blues squad that traveled to Nyon, Tariq Uwakwe was named among the substitutes in the game.
For Porto, defender Isah Musa was equally left out for Porto but his teammate Fidelis Emmanuel Kuku was included on the bench.
Daishwan Redan's early goal was cancelled out by strikes from the opposition's Diogo Queirós and João Mário while Joshua Grant's 86th minute effort ensured the tie went to penalties.
Chelsea goalkeeper, Jammie Cumming was the hero of the shoot-out, making three stops against all of Porto's Diogo Leite, Rui Pires and Diogo Bessa as Chelsea clinched their place in Monday's showpiece.
Both of Uwakwe and Kuku were unused substitutes for their sides in the game.
Chelsea would now face either of Manchester City or Barcelona in the final of the competition, as they bid to cart away the trophy for the third time.
